Legal Brokers Ltd started life approximately 6 years ago as an online conveyancing referrer.

 

Jon Hilton, LBL Director, agreed a £500 overdraft with the bank and four weeks later www.conveyancingbrokers.co.uk was born. It's had a face lift or two since it's inception. At it's peak the site was generating 20 cases a day.

 

From that sprung the current www.legalbrokers.co.uk which is essentially our workhorse site. Initially we simply used it as a mechanism to gain Conveyancing enquiries which we passed on to lawyers.

 

At the same time we started work on PI work, in the days before the Ministry of Justice existed, via www.make-a-claim.com & www.accidentsolicitors.org.uk. Both sites look a tad tired these days. Although if you type "accident solicitors" into Google our site is still there on the first page.   

 

With the volume of conveyancing work we were generating (and it became a struggle getting lawyers to pay out on accepted claims) we "parked" the PI marketing in favour of property work. We were only doing 15 or so cases a month.

 

We also experimented with a video website, www.funkytv.com, in the hope we'd sell out to Google for billions. That hope hasn't materialised. Very sad.

 

With the introduction of Home Information Packs we invested in all the case tracking automated software "stuff" and whilst HIPs were alive they became 50% of our turnover.

 

At the point we saw their demise appear on the horison we began working on Property Searches. It was a natural progression. We've done over 10,000 searches to this point.

 

In the Northwest we generally carry out those searches ourselves. Outside that area we instruct third party firms. We wanted to share that work with Legal Brokers Ltd franchisees hence the word "franchise" entered our vocabulary.

 

Additionally we registered with the Ministry of Justice to be able to take on Payment Protection and Personal Injury  claims. The turnover from PPI cases fell flat during the 2010 / 2011 Judicial Review but matters are back on track, now.

 

Whilst everything we've done has been predominantly "online" we're gaining PPI, and to a lesser extent PI, through our "offline" activities. Why ? Because if you pay to advertise online it's very easy to get into a bidding war.... and then the only folk that win are Google themselves. ie. you fight to stand still.

 

At the same time we've spent tens of thousands of pounds on Search Engine Optimisation. With very little reward. In short we've learnt a lot of very costly lessons.

 

Our online experiences have led us to work, in an MOJ approved manner, with Call Centres. We can now target specific postcodes to get various messages accross. Whether that be simply promoting firms to the general public or as a mechanism to pick up alsorts of legal work.

 

As an incidental point the "buying and selling" of law firms has been a growing source of activity for us. The company name seems to lead us in that direction. 

 

In terms of turnover, in our last but one accounts and including HIPs, we were just over the million mark. That was approximately 18 months ago. It's slipped back since due to the governments removal of the accursed HIPs.

 

Ironically whilst turnover has fallen, as shown in the last set of accounts, profitability has increased.
